The AP Poll was released today and for the first time this season, Missouri finds themselves ranked inside the top 25.

Missouri received 233 votes, 23 more than Iowa, 75 less than Cincinnati. I’ll be curious to watch how this progresses. Missouri has two more games before their next bye, and they’re road games against Vanderbilt and Kentucky.
